January 13, 201115 yr Btw, my new favorite iPhone app / music service is Mog. $10 a month, but then again you have unlimited access to any and all music you want. It streams at 64k while on 3G, but the one great aspect is that you can download albums/songs to your iphone at 320k when you want to do some more serious listening. The interface is wonderful and easy to navigate....and it encourages you to download and listen to all sorts of things you normally wouldn't.

January 13, 201115 yr So, VLC for iPhone has been removed from the App Store. Even though it was free, the App Store's DRM killed it due to violation of the GNU license or something like that. Being that it was free, I personally don't see what the problem was. I know that some companies can install software via Safari for iPhone, bypassing the app store, like IBM Traveler software that lets some big companies integrate their contacts, calendar and email with the iPhone. There used to be a tethering hack that could be installed via Safari as well. So, I wonder why more companies don't/can't do this, so that we don't have to jailbreak our phones to get around the App store? On the VZW iPhone front, I think having a Wifi hotspot feature built into the OS is nice. It's been reported that the iPhone OS 4.3 beta for ATT has a Wifi Hotspot feature included, but I wont use it if I have to give up my unlimited data plan for a 2Gb plan. But since VZW can't do data and voice at the same time, it seems like it may be a big compromise for many. I do seem to recall my old VZW Windows Mobile phone would pause the data connection if I was surfing, so that I could take an incoming phone call. So it may not be all bad.
